A crumbling empire

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

There are some highly talented people here. Unlimited time off is a good benefit.

Cons

The creative departments outsource all of their biggest projects for branding, websites and applications because they don’t trust any of the people they hire to work on these internally. You’ll mostly be stuck doing cleanup work instead of creating anything innovative and exciting. Management will tell you what they think you want to hear instead of being honest. They don’t value loyalty, and keep those that have been here the longest underpaid. The default answer to anything within this company is “budget restraints”. The turnover is very high, and there isn’t a week that goes by where there aren’t new changes happening. People are constantly quitting or getting fired.
